In the not-so-distant future, aviation could see a groundbreaking transformation with the introduction of e-fuel, a third-generation sustainable aviation fuel. E-fuel, also known as 'power to liquid' fuel, involves converting carbon dioxide and hydrogen into jet fuel, offering a net-zero emission solution. The process, although relatively straightforward scientifically, poses a significant challenge in terms of cost. E-fuels are currently priced at $8,720 per ton, making them considerably more expensive than bio-based SAF and conventional jet fuel. The industry is striving to scale up e-fuel production to commercial levels, facing obstacles such as high plant costs and a scarcity of the required hydrogen type. Despite these challenges, the potential benefits of e-fuel are immense, with the ability to produce jet fuel without feedstock limitations and land-use concerns associated with bio-feed SAF. Political support and investments are deemed crucial in overcoming the cost challenges and scaling up e-fuel production. Several carriers have already started exploring alternative fuels, with some operating flights using bio-based sustainable aviation fuel.
